DFSee version 8.02 has been released 

This version has enhancements for SMART imaging/cloning,
JFS enhancements, log/trace additions and a few bug-fixes.

You can now make a SMART-compressed image from a whole disk,
and view the disk-usage (allocation) for a complete disk:

        Display -> Disk/filesystem Usage



DFSee is a very powerful disk-utility with disk partitioning,
filesystem and disk analysis, file recovery, UNDELETE for HPFS
JFS, and NTFS, resizing, imaging and cloning.

Most important functional changes since 8.01:

 - ALLOC     Area support HPFS, FAT, JFS and NTFS filesystems
 - CLONE     Smart sector support (skip) on disk or filesystem
 - COMPARE   Smart sector support (skip) on disk or filesystem
 - DFSDISK   Allow display of all LVM information in FS modes
 - FIXBOOT   Fixed a program-crash in FAT fixboot (trap)
 - FIXPBR    Better Geo/HiddenSector warnings, optional fix
 - JFS       More error reporting on damaged fileset structure
 - LOGGING   Support for maximum logfile size and log rotation
 - MENU      File -> Trace to 3 cyclic files of limited size
 - MENU <F9> Supports allocation display (usage) for a whole disk
 - Mode=xxx  Menu wording changed a bit for more clarity
 - SHIFTR    Shift all data in a range of sectors to the RIGHT
 - SLT2LIST  Add selected SLT sectors to list for later analysis
 - \path     command for the JFS filesystem (find file by path)
